In the old version of Dreamweaver (Creative Suite 5), in the upper right-hand corner of an open web page it would tell you which template was being used. I can’t find anything similar to this in Creative Cloud.
How do I determine which template is attached to an html file in the Dreamweaver CC interface?
With child page open, look at the 2nd line of your code.
<!-- InstanceBegin template="/Templates/mainTemplate.dwt" codeOutsideHTMLIsLocked="false" -->
Or go to Tools > Templates > Open Attached Template.
